(d) <br /> <br />If there is a request for decapitation of a bite animal, the fee for this service is <br />$40. <br /> <br />(e) <br /> <br />Dead stray domestic or wild animal disposal by cremation is available at $7.50 <br />per body. <br /> <br />If an injured impound animal is brought to our facility needing medical care, there <br />is an initial $25 veterinary fee plus the cost of any treatment during the impound <br />period. <br /> <br />(g) <br /> <br />The Humane Society will bill on a monthly basis and the City will pay the <br />Humane Society within 30 days of receipt of the invoice. <br /> <br /> Fees may be increased on an annual basis so that the fees paid bv the City are <br />commensurate with, but no less favorable then, those paid by other municipalities using the <br />Humane Society's services. <br /> <br />8. Reclaim Rights and Obligations. <br /> <br />(a) <br /> <br />Each animal impounded by the City and placed with the Humane Society <br />pursuant to this Agreement may be reclaimed by the owner during the impound <br />period upon verification of ownership, subject to the following provisions. <br /> <br />(b) <br /> <br />The Humane Society will charge to any verified owner who reclaims an animal <br />all costs and fees incurred by the Humane Society. The Humane Society will <br />keep complete and accurate records of all such charges assessed and any <br />payments made by reclaiming owners. <br /> <br />(c) <br /> <br />(d) <br /> <br />The Humane Society may set and collect such impound, board and veterinary care <br />fees for impounded animals as it deems appropriate and may refuse to return the <br />animal to its owner if he or she fails to pay those fees in full. Any such fees <br />collected will be retained by the Humane Society and will not be credited against <br />any fees owed or paid by the City, except that fees collected from an owner and <br />previously paid by the City shall be credited or refunded to the City. <br /> <br />In connection with bringing an animal to the Humane Society, the City may <br />institute a claim or proceeding against the person responsible for an animal (the <br />"defendant"), based upon or pursuant to C.R.S. 18-9-204.5, or another applicable <br />statute, ordinance, r~gulation or law. The City hereby agrees that within one <br />busineSs day after it institutes such a claim or proceeding, it will provide the <br />Humane Society with the following information, in writing: (i) the name, address <br />and telephone number of the defendant; (ii)the date that the defendant was <br />charged with a violation of C.R.S. 18-9-204.5 or any other applicable statute, <br />ordinance, regulation or law; and (iii)a copy of the Arrest Report or Summons <br />and Citation related to the defendant. The City also agrees to promptly provide <br />the Humane Society with any available information as to the status of the pending <br />prosecution against the defendant (including any request or application for bail). <br /> <br /> <br />
